Keynote talk exploring how to apply observability principles to LLM-powered applications in production environments. Learn how CEO and Cofounder of Honeycomb, Christine Yen, approaches the challenges of integrating Large Language Models into existing products. Discover why, despite their seemingly magical capabilities, LLMs ultimately present familiar operational challenges including performance issues, accuracy problems, and user confusion. Understand how to treat LLMs as architectural "black boxes" similar to APIs and databases, but with inherent unpredictability and probabilistic outputs. Gain practical insights on implementing observability best practices and Service Level Objectives (SLOs) in highly parameterized AI systems with nondeterministic outputs. This 15-minute CNCF keynote from KubeCon + CloudNativeCon Europe equips developers and engineers with strategies to confidently navigate the complexities of deploying and maintaining AI-driven applications in production.
